Land? if you mean residential land or bungalow lot,
you can either finance
A) purchase of Land ONLY. then MOF 90%, rates BLR-1.6/1.8%/...
It will be treated as housing loan also.

or
B) purchase of Land plus construction cost.
so will be "Property under construction"

differentiate what type of the land that u wan to finance.

Agriculture land? bungalow land? industrial land?
each of them has different margin of finance and the rates are vary based on whether the applicant apply under company name or individual name. Rates are subject to the location as well. if the location strategic , the rate will be more lower
